重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1、include string.h include malloc.h // 将strRes中的t替换为s,替换成功返回1,否则返回0。
创新互联公司2013年成立,是专业互联网技术服务公司,拥有项目网站建设、网站设计网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元柯城做网站,已为上家服务,为柯城各地企业和个人服务,联系电话:028-86922220
2、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。
3、第一步,依次单击visual C ++ 0的“文件”--“新建”--“文件”--“C++ Source File”选项,见下图,转到下面的步骤。第二步,执行完上面的操作之后,定义变量,代码见下图,转到下面的步骤。
4、我以前刚学C++的时候写过一个相似的程序,如果你要的是纯C语言下的编程,那么你就参考一下,这个算法的原理是一样的,即读入一个字符就显示出来。当然你也可以考虑其他实现方式。
getchar()getchar()是stdio.h中的库函数,它的作用是从stdin流中读入一个字符,如果stdin有数据的话不用输入它就可以直接读取了。
scanf(%d,&ch)不接收字符,因为在缓冲区里面,由后面的getchar()接收。
首先你用info()来初始化x和y的值然后调用diamond()画出一个由xy组成的图形,除去getchar()后会得到异常的图形好像被输入了很多回车符,问题就在这里。
用 while(getchar()!=\n);就是让getchar吞掉scanf缓存中的字符,直到输入一个回车符为止。
file[20]=copy C:\a.txt c:\b.txtsystem(file);这是最简单的办法。
替换函数主要有strtr(),str_repalce()这两个函数。
第一步,依次单击visual C ++ 0的“文件”--“新建”--“文件”--“C++ Source File”选项,见下图,转到下面的步骤。第二步,执行完上面的操作之后,定义变量,代码见下图,转到下面的步骤。
C语言提供了文件操作,但是替换文件的某一行比较麻烦,下面一个参考方法,文件中存贮的内容如下所示:通过使用下面的几个函数,fopen,fprintf,fscanf,fseek,ftell 。